Working as an electrician is seen as a reliable and well-paying career even for those without a degree. To get experience, you may begin as an apprentice. An electrician installs, maintains, and fixes the electrical power, communications, lighting, and control systems in residences, workplaces, and industries.

How to Become an Electrical Contractor in Canada

If you want to work as an electrician, you will have to put in the time. It takes time to finish training and get a license. This industry is regulated under the direction of the Ontario College of Trades. Consequently, you need to have a Certificate of Qualification (C of Q) to work as a journeyperson.

This process comprises:

  • First, registering with the Ontario College of Trades, completing 840 hours of classroom instruction, completing 8160 hours of on-the-job training, and passing the certification exam for electricians
  • Next, apply for journeyperson certification and registration
  • Lastly, you should anticipate completing five years of training and working as an apprentice before earning your certification. In total, completed an average of 9,000 hours

The Average electrician’s salary in Canada

An electrician in Canada makes, on average, $62,327 per year, or $31.96 per hour. The average yearly salary for an experienced worker is $72,922, although entry-level positions start at $54,550.

Benefits of Electrician Jobs in Canada

  • Job Protection: Electricians are highly sought after and their expertise is highly valued in a wide range of sectors. There will always be a need for electricians as long as power is needed, which guarantees job security.
  • Many career options: electricians can work in a variety of environments, including commercial, industrial, and residential. Because of this variety, electricians can choose a specialization that aligns with their goals and interests outside of work.
  • Competitive Income: Generally speaking, electricians make competitive salaries that rise with experience and skill. Generally speaking, unionized electricians have even better pay packages.
  • Physical Work: Being an electrician is a fulfilling and interesting career for people who enjoy working with their hands and finding solutions to real-world issues.
  • Competencies in demand: There is a steady need for qualified electricians, and as these professionals’ abilities are transferrable between nations and regions, there are chances for both international employment and relocation.
  • Career Advancement: Obtaining further certificates and licenses, taking on supervisory roles, or even starting their own electrical contracting companies are all ways that electricians can further their careers.
  • Regular Work Schedule: Many electricians maintain regular work hours and schedules, which can help maintain a healthy work-life balance.
  • Absence of reliance: Electricians often have the choice to work alone or collaboratively, giving them the freedom to choose the type of workplace that best fits their needs.
  • Problem Solving: Electrical work is intellectually interesting since electricians often deal with complex electrical challenges that call for critical thinking and problem-solving skills.

Does Canada need electricians?

In Canada, there is a great demand for electricians because there aren’t enough specialists in the field. For example, in Canada, there were 5,275 openings for electricians in the third quarter of 2022, except for power systems and industrial electricians.
